    The underdog Saints defeated the Colts by a score of 31–17, earning the franchise its first Super Bowl win. [9] [10] The game was played at Sun Life Stadium (now Hard Rock Stadium ) in Miami Gardens, Florida , for the fifth time (and in South Florida for the tenth time), on February 7, 2010, which was the latest calendar date for a Super Bowl ...

    The Saints did not have their first winning season until 1987, their twenty-first season in the league. That same season, the Saints made their first playoff appearance. During the team's worst season in 1980 (in terms of win-loss percentage) the fans began to wear paper bags over their heads to games and started to call the team the " 'Aints".

    Hurricane Katrina devastated the city of New Orleans, Louisiana on August 29, 2005 and caused extensive damage to the Louisiana Superdome. As a result, the National Football League (NFL)'s New Orleans Saints were unable to play any home games at the Superdome for the entire 2005 NFL regular season.
